Cost Comparison
Comparison of investment and operating costs between Modan Industrial Energy-saving Air Conditioner and traditional air conditioners: taking a space of 1000m² in area and 3.5m in height as an example
| Air Conditioner Type | Traditional Household Air Conditioner | Central Air Conditioner | Evaporative Cooling Industrial Energy-saving Air Conditioner |
| Required Quantity | 13 units of 5HP air conditioners | 1 unit of 60HP air-cooled air/water chiller combination | 5 units of 5HP energy-saving air conditioners |
| Investment Cost | Average about 10,000 yuan per unit, total: 130,000 yuan | Average about 250,000 yuan per set including auxiliary materials, total: 250,000 yuan | Average 22,000 yuan per set, total: 110,000 yuan |
| Total Power | 45 kW | 40 kW | 20 kW |
| Power Consumption/Hour | 45 kWh | 40 kWh | 20 kWh |
| Power Consumption/10 Hours/Day | 450 kWh | 400 kWh | 200 kWh |
| Electricity cost calculated at 1 yuan per kWh (26 days/month) | 11700 yuan | 10400 yuan | 5200 yuan |
| Advantages and Disadvantages | Each air conditioner is independently controlled, with small coverage area, slow heat exchange speed and low efficiency | Good cooling effect but unable to control independently, high investment and use costs. | Good cooling effect, large air volume, wide coverage area and comprehensive air supply methods; can be controlled independently or centrally, with low investment and use costs. |
